Abstract

The limestones located near the Beni Bahdel dam gives an abundant fauna of ammonites allowing the recognition of the levels of passage from Aalenian to Bajocian and the Discites, Sauzei and Humphriesianum zones. This fauna, full of stephanoceratidae is described. Two new species are proposed.
